I used the gum once, during one attempt at quitting. I was also using Zyban and the Patch (I needed a lot of help). The gum was just for those times when the cravings were really bad. I started swapping regular chewing gum with the nicorette, so that I wouldn't be getting too much nicotine (and end up swapping one type of nicotine for another). I used the extra-strong cinnamon flavoured Dentyne gum. The stuff they have now is quite a bit better than the original stuff. My dad tried it and it was so bad it made him want to gag, and he'd have to have a cigarette to get rid of the taste.
